public ActionResult Create(FankuiAddViewModel model) { try { FankuiDto dto = new FankuiDto(); dto.FankuiResult = model.FankuiResult; dto.FankuiSource = model.FankuiSource; dto.FankuiDescription = model.FankuiDescription; dto.FankuiSendTime = System.DateTime.Now; dto.FankuiTime = System.DateTime.Now; dto.FankuiStatus = "已查看"; dto.FankuiCustomerId = model.FankuiCustomerId; dto.FankuiDoctor = int.Parse(System.Web.HttpContext.Current.Request.Cookies["UserId"].Value); // TODO: Add insert logic here string JsonString = JsonHelper.JsonSerializerBySingleData(dto); Message msg = CMSService.Insert("Fankui", JsonString); return RedirectTo("/Fankui/Index/" + model.FankuiCustomerId, msg.MessageInfo); // return RedirectToAction("Index"); } catch { Message msg = new Message(); msg.MessageInfo = "插入操作失败了,请检查是否输入错误"; return RedirectTo("/Fankui/Create/" + model.FankuiCustomerId, msg.MessageInfo); } }
// // GET: /Fankui/Create public ActionResult Create(int id) { FankuiAddViewModel model = new FankuiAddViewModel(); ViewData["FankuiCategory"] = MyService.GetCategorySelectList("CategoryParentId=44"); ViewData["Source"] = MyService.GetCategorySelectList("CategoryParentId=50"); model.FankuiCustomerId = id; ViewBag.CustomerName = MyService.CustomerIdToName("CustomerId=" + id); return View(model); }